Sustainable Products



When preparing your green restroom remodel, consider making use of lasting materials to lessen your environmental influence. Choosing lasting products not only minimizes the deficiency of natural deposits but also aids in creating a healthier indoor environment for you and your family members.

Among the first sustainable products you can use is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ing grass that can be harvested and restored swiftly. It's strong, durable, and can be utilized for floor covering, countertops, and even as a material for bathroom accessories like toothbrush owners and soap meals.

Another lasting material to consider is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be changed into gorgeous ceramic tiles for your shower room walls or floor covering. It not only adds an unique touch to your restroom layout but likewise reduces the amount of waste that ends up in land fills. Additionally, recycled glass requires much less energy to create compared to virgin glass.

Energy-Efficient Fixtures



To better decrease your environmental influence and create an energy-efficient washroom, consider upgrading to energy-efficient components. These fixtures not only help you save on energy prices however likewise add to a greener planet.

Right here are 5 energy-efficient fixtures to take into consideration for your restroom remodel:

- LED Illumination: Replace traditional incandescent light b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ights. They eat less power, last longer, and supply brilliant lighting.

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Mount low-flow showerheads to reduce water intake while keeping a refreshing shower experience.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Go with motion-sensor taps that instantly switch off when not in use, protecting against water wastefulness.

- Energy-Efficient Ventilation Fans: Mount energy-efficient air flow fans that eliminate excess moisture from the washroom while utilizing less electrical energy.

Water Conservation Strategies



Think about implementing water preservation techniques to reduce water waste and advertise lasting methods in your washroom remodel.

By taking on these methods, you can help in reducing your water usage and contribute to the preservation of this priceless source.

One effective approach is to mount low-flow fixtures, such as low-flow toilets and showerheads. These components are developed to limit water circulation, without compromising on performance. By utilizing much less water per flush or shower, you can dramatically reduce your water use.

An additional water conservation approach is to repair any kind of leakages in your washroom. Even little leaks can add up to a substantial amount of water waste gradually. Frequently look for leakages in your taps, pipelines, and bathrooms, and fix them without delay to avoid unneeded water loss.

Furthermore, take into consideration executing a greywater system in your shower room remodel. Greywater describes the reasonably clean wastewater from showers, tubs, and sinks. By setting up a greywater system, you can capture and reuse this water for purposes like flushing toilets or sprinkling plants. This not only minimizes water usage yet additionally helps stop pollution by diverting wastewater far from sewage systems.

Finally, exercising conscious water use routines can make a large distinction. Simple actions like turning off the tap while brushing your teeth or taking shorter showers can considerably reduce water waste.
